  • Patent number: 7771199
    Abstract: A surgical tool for preparing a surgical sinus-lift osteotomy has a defined thread geometry in series with an osteotome tip to cut, crack and push bone from the sinus floor upward into the sinus cavity in a tactual, gentle and controlled motion. The apical osteotome tip is driven into a pre-drilled pilot osteotomy after the cutting threads are engaged and rotated until the sinus floor is cracked free. Once the bony sinus floor is cracked free, a fluid passageway can be pressurized with a sterile fluid at a defined pressure to release and push the sinus membrane upward into the sinus cavity to create a desired apical cavity for grafting while minimizing the risk of compromising or tearing the sinus membrane.

  • Patent number: 7341454
    Abstract: An endosseous dental implant system has an externally threaded root-formed base 2 with self-tapping flutes 5 formed into apical threads of the root-formed base for easy insertion and immediate locking in an osteotomy. The coronal portion of the base has either a male or a female self-locking tapered friction held post that includes an apical anti-rotational polygon 7, 23 to lock a prosthetic attachment to the base once attached.

  • Patent number: 6887275
    Abstract: A maxillofacial anchoring and distraction system having an internally threaded anchoring or distraction fixture (12) and a selected length jack screw (14) for placement in an osteotomy. To minimize required bone height, a cut-away bone screw (16) or a solid mesh tip (17) is provided for insertion in bone in a direction generally perpendicular to the longitudinal axes of the anchoring and jack screws. A flat surface portion (16c, 17a) serves as a reaction surface for the distal end of the jack screw. In a second embodiment a sealing screw (24) is used with distraction fixture (20) modified to include a sealing surface. After completion of distraction the sealing screw is used to seal off the distraction fixture for conversion into an implant suitable for receiving conventional prosthetic components.

  • Patent number: 6454567
    Abstract: A combined internal polygonal and locking drive tool (10,10′) used to engage a mating external implant mounting and drive fixture (12). The locking drive has an internal tapered locking drive section (10b) which is longitudinally in series with an internal polygonal section (10d) and has its largest diameter slightly larger than the smallest diameter of the internal polygonal portion. The combined delivery and drive tool can be incorporated with an external hand drive or power drill drive surface configuration.

  • Patent number: 6138539
    Abstract: A dental torque ratchet head and driver handle (8) is formed with a chamber (12a) between first (30) and second (32) pivotably mounted handle members which receives a plastic insert (14) formed in a configuration selected so that the insert fractures at a selected torque to thereby ensure the application of a precalibrated level or torque to an abutment or prosthetic screw of an implant. A solid metal insert (14') can be used to convert the tool to a straight ratchet tool.

  • Patent number: 5971985
    Abstract: A self-locking and threaded bone tack screw device (10) for fixing and retaining tissue grafts and synthetic membranes directly to a maxillofacial bone graft site. The tack has an oversized cylindrical dome shaped head (14) for retaining the tissue and synthetic membrane to the bone graft site and a hexagonal recess (14a) for easy insertion and removal of the device. The tip of the device incorporates a sharp pin point (12a) to easily pierce the tissue and membrane and initially penetrate into the bone graft site. A locking flange (12c) locks into the bone graft site in a single direction. A self-tapping screw thread (12f) is provided for driving the pin point tip into the bone graft site. Incorporation of the self-locking pin point tip in series with the self-tapping thread allows the hexagonal tool driven bone tack to be easily inserted and removed from the graft site without compromising its fixation.
